Patient Transfer Service (1122)

On the special instructions of CM Punjab, free Patient Transfer Service was initiated. The service was initiated in collaboration with Rescue 1122. The Service has so far rescued millions of victims of road traffic crashes, medical emergencies and disasters while maintaining an average response time of 7 minutes and standards in all Districts & Tehsils of Punjab. The Punjab Emergency Service (Rescue 1122) was initially started as an Emergency Ambulance Service on 14th October 2004 as a pilot project from Lahore. After the success of this pilot project, Emergency Ambulance Service was established in 12 major cities of Punjab and subsequently in all Districts of the Punjab province with a population of over 80 million. In spite of the fact that Rescue & Fire Services were also established subsequently, over 97% emergency calls are still related to Emergency Ambulance Service. The main beneficiaries of this Service have been the victims of road traffic accidents whom earlier people were afraid to help due to medico-legal reasons.

It was for the first time that emergency medical technicians were trained for this emergency ambulance service and emergency ambulances of international standards were manufactured in Pakistan. This training and indigenous fabrication of ambulances made the project cost effective and sustainable resulting in success of Rescue 1122. As most of the beneficiaries of this Service include young bread-winners of the society hence it has had a favorable socio-economic impact.

Salient Features

Enlisted below are some prime salient features of the same:

  • Free of cost
  • 24/7 at service
  • Very quick response time
  • Safe and sound patient transfer from one hospital to other
  • Prevent travel difficulties and avoid expense
  • Trained and efficient staff
  • Proper first Aid-kit available
